Performance Side-by-Side
When comparing performance under real-world conditions, several key parameters stand out:
- Switchover Speed: A standard backup inverter typically takes 15 to 30 milliseconds to transition to battery power, which can cause computers to reset. A dedicated UPS offers a sub-10ms transition, keeping sensitive electronics active without interruption.
- Output Waveform: Older square wave inverters can cause humming noises in ceiling fans and damage delicate appliances, whereas modern sine wave systems deliver clean, utility-grade power.
- Thermal Efficiency: Pamarru's Warm-Humid climate demands systems with intelligent thermal management to prevent overheating during high-ambient-temperature operations.
Lifespan and Durability
Durability is a primary concern for practical buyers in Pamarru. Traditional power backup systems rely on external lead-acid or tubular batteries that typically degrade within a few years due to active chemical wear and high ambient temperatures. These legacy setups require frequent water topping and regular maintenance to sustain performance. In contrast, modern integrated lithium-based backup systems are designed for a lifespan exceeding ten years. Their sealed, solid-state architecture eliminates the typical degradation pathways associated with older battery technologies, making them highly reliable over the long term.
Cost of Ownership for Pamarru Buyers
Evaluating the total cost of ownership reveals significant differences between legacy configurations and modern integrated systems:
- Maintenance Overhead: Traditional tubular battery setups require periodic distilled water top-ups and terminal cleaning, adding recurring maintenance effort and cost.
- Replacement Cycles: While a legacy battery may require replacement multiple times over a decade, an integrated system operates reliably without battery swaps.
- Space and Safety: Multi-component systems require dedicated, well-ventilated floor space to vent corrosive fumes, whereas integrated wall-mounted units save valuable space and operate silently without emissions.
